The notice requestioning a General Meeting was received by Rangers on 01 Aug. Charles Green was appointed as consultant on 02 Aug. Green brought in Mather when Green was CEO and - remember - he had a role in appointing Walter back as a non-exec Director. In my view Charles Green is there as part of the defence against the removal of CM, BStockbridge and BSmart as Directors. The share price is low - halved in value in the last 4 months. Investors - mainly institutional ones I suppose - will want to see that improved. And I suspect the price creates an opportunity for a takeover bid (buying low and looking to capitalise when Rangers are eventually back playing in Europe). The former PwC connection would imply to me that money is in the wings or being assembled otherwise why poke your head above the parapet to be put into the glare of Supporter and media spotlight.

So if a General Meeting is held it seems to me to boil down to - do shareholders believe that a Mather / Stockbridge / Green (as financial consultant) / Smith and McCoist team stand the best chance to deliver the sort of shareholder value they want to see (recognising that to do that there must be the most successful football team on the pitch year afere year for the next bundle of years to get back to money-spinning / attention-getting CL football). Or do shareholders believe that a Murray / Blin team plus whoever they have as financial backers can do that job?

If the Murray / Blin camp are tracking social media responses to their request for the removal of Mather, Stockbridge and Smart then as a shareholder they do not have my support and they are wasting their time. In the absence of any hard, factual evidence to cause me to think to the contrary my view is that a Mather / Stockbridge and Green team has all the skill, experience and firepower necessary to deliver for Rangers and to take the share value back up and to generate the funds for the football team - yes this is still about football - to achieve Rangers' football ambitions.
